SiO2 + 4HF = SiF4 + 2H2O, what mass of HF is necessary to produce 12.91g of the SiF4?

Respuesta :

gbustamantegarcia054 gbustamantegarcia054
  • 11-10-2019

Answer:

mass HF = 9.928 g

Explanation:

  • SiO2 + 4HF = SiF4 + 2H2O

∴ Mw SiO4 = 104.0791 g/mol

∴ Mw HF = 20.01 g/mol

⇒ mol HF = 12.91 gSiF4 * (mol SiF4 / 104.0791 g) * (4 mol HF / mol SIF4) = 0.496 mol

⇒ mass HF = 0.496 mol HF * ( 20.01 g HF / mol HF ) = 9.928 g HF
